Should You Buy a 1989 Sterling M8500 Acterra?

The 1989 Sterling M8500 Acterra is a robust passenger van that combines utility with comfort. Powered by a 7.3L V8 diesel engine, it delivers 190 horsepower and an impressive 420 lb-ft of torque, making it suitable for various driving conditions. The rear-wheel drive layout enhances its stability and handling, while the manual transmission provides a more engaging driving experience. Although specific fuel economy figures are not available, diesel engines are generally known for their efficiency and longevity, making this vehicle a reliable choice for those needing a durable van for family or work-related activities.

This vehicle is ideal for buyers looking for a versatile passenger van that can handle both daily commutes and longer road trips. Its spacious interior and strong engine make it suitable for transporting larger groups or cargo, although exact seating capacity is unspecified. The Sterling M8500 Acterra stands out for its blend of power and practicality, making it a solid option for those who prioritize functionality in their vehicle choice.
